fe|ver|few «FEE vuhr fyoo», noun.
a bushy, perennial European herb of the composite family with small, white and yellow, daisylike flowers, formerly used as a febrifuge. It is a species of chrysanthemum.
[Old English feferfugie, and < Anglo-French fewerfue, both < Late Latin febrifugia < Latin febris fever + fugāre drive away. See etym. of doublet febrifuge. (Cf.febrifuge)]
